Abstract

Image filtering is the use of computer graphics algorithms to enhance the quality of digital images or to extract information about their content. However rendering very large size digital images on a single machine is a performance bottleneck. To address this we propose parallelising this application on a desktop Grid environment. For parallelizing this application we use the Alchemi Desktop Grid environment and the resulting framework is referred to as ImageGrid. ImageGrid allows the parallel execution of linear digital filters algorithms on images. We observed acceptable speed up as a result of parallelising filtering operation through ImageGrid.
